Analysis

The most recent figure for coffee, green — gross production value in United States of America is 213,742 1000 SLC, measured in 2024. That is the highest value across all 34 years on record.

The figure is up 59.3% on the previous year and up 110.5% over ten years.

Over the whole period, coffee, green — gross production value in United States of America peaked at 213,742 1000 SLC in 2024 and was at its lowest, 3,265 1000 SLC, in 1992.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Coffee, green — Gross Production Value in United States of America, year by year

Annual values for Coffee, green — Gross Production Value (current thousand SLC) in United States of America, 1991 to 2024.
Year 1000 SLC Change
1991 3,920 1000 SLC
1992 3,265 1000 SLC -16.7%
1993 5,238 1000 SLC +60.4%
1994 9,630 1000 SLC +83.8%
1995 12,963 1000 SLC +34.6%
1996 16,623 1000 SLC +28.2%
1997 21,562 1000 SLC +29.7%
1998 19,775 1000 SLC -8.3%
1999 16,807 1000 SLC -15.0%
2000 23,076 1000 SLC +37.3%
2001 19,606 1000 SLC -15.0%
2002 23,236 1000 SLC +18.5%
2003 24,038 1000 SLC +3.5%
2004 19,878 1000 SLC -17.3%
2005 37,305 1000 SLC +87.7%
2006 31,388 1000 SLC -15.9%
2007 37,478 1000 SLC +19.4%
2008 29,609 1000 SLC -21.0%
2009 31,351 1000 SLC +5.9%
2010 28,588 1000 SLC -8.8%
2011 31,537 1000 SLC +10.3%
2012 41,297 1000 SLC +30.9%
2013 43,399 1000 SLC +5.1%
2014 101,542 1000 SLC +134.0%
2015 80,302 1000 SLC -20.9%
2016 71,297 1000 SLC -11.2%
2017 83,422 1000 SLC +17.0%
2018 106,497 1000 SLC +27.7%
2019 102,806 1000 SLC -3.5%
2020 80,803 1000 SLC -21.4%
2021 210,746 1000 SLC +160.8%
2022 125,965 1000 SLC -40.2%
2023 134,172 1000 SLC +6.5%
2024 213,742 1000 SLC +59.3%

The domain provides detailed data on the value of agricultural production that is calculated by the agricultural production data and the price data at farm gate. Thus, the value of production measures the agricultural production in monetary terms at the farm gate level.
